Strainers are critical components in various industrial systems, ensuring the smooth operation of processes by filtering out debris and preventing damage to downstream equipment. However, like all mechanical devices, strainers can encounter issues that affect their performance.
Understanding how to troubleshoot common problems such as clogging, leakage, and pressure drops is essential for maintaining system efficiency and longevity.
This guide provides expert advice on identifying and resolving these frequent industrial strainer issues.

Clogging
Symptoms:
- Reduced flow rate
- Increased pressure drop across the strainer
- System struggling to maintain performance
Causes:
- Accumulation of debris on the strainer screen
- Inadequate cleaning frequency
- Incorrect strainer size or mesh size for the application
Solutions:
- Regular Cleaning: Increase the frequency of cleaning the strainer basket or screen to prevent buildup.
- Correct Sizing: Ensure the strainer size and mesh size are appropriate for the application to handle the expected debris load.
- Backwashing: For self-cleaning strainers, ensure the backwash cycle is functioning correctly and adjust the frequency as needed.
Leakage
Symptoms:
- Visible leaks from the strainer body or connections
- Dampness or corrosion around the strainer area
Causes:
- Worn or damaged gaskets and seals
- Corrosion or damage to the strainer body
- Loose connections or bolts
Solutions:
- Gasket and Seal Replacement: Inspect gaskets and seals for wear or damage and replace them as necessary.
- Tighten Connections: Check all bolts and connections for tightness. Tighten any loose components to ensure a proper seal.
- Corrosion Inspection: Examine the strainer body for signs of corrosion or damage. If significant, consider replacing the strainer or affected parts.

Pressure Drops
Symptoms:
- Unusually high pressure differential across the strainer
- The system is unable to reach the desired flow rates
Causes:
- Clogged strainer screen
- Incorrect strainer size causing flow restriction
- Damaged or deformed strainer elements affecting flow
Solutions:
- Debris Removal: Clean the strainer basket or screen to remove debris causing the blockage.
- Strainer Evaluation: Assess if the current strainer size meets the system’s flow requirements. Upgrade to a larger size if necessary.
- Element Inspection: Check the strainer elements for damage or deformation. Replace any compromised parts to restore proper flow.

Expert Tips for Preventive Maintenance
- Routine Inspections: Regularly inspect strainers for signs of wear, damage, or clogging. Establish a maintenance schedule based on system demands and debris load.
- Proper Installation: Ensure strainers are installed correctly according to manufacturer guidelines, with attention to flow direction and accessibility for maintenance.
- System Analysis: Periodically review system performance to identify any changes that might necessitate adjustments in strainer maintenance or configuration.
